I'm using NtEmacs on WinXP Pro. I've installed Cygwin and compiled
w3m. I've added w3m-specific stuff (culled from the archives of this
group). When I try to browse using "M-x w3m" I just get "Reading
<site>..." and nothing ever gets displayed.
Details:
OS: WinXP pro (Swedish)
Emacs: "GNU Emacs 21.3.1 (i386-msvc-nt5.1.2600) of 2003-03-28 on buffy"
w3m: w3m version w3m/0.4.1,
options lang=en,color,ansi-color,mouse,menu,cookie,ssl,
external-uri-loader,w3mmailer,nntp,gopher,alarm,mark
emacs-w3m: emacs-w3m-1.3.4
>From my ~/.emacs:
--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
;; w3m stuff
(setq load-path (cons (expand-file-name
"~/src/emacs-w3m-1.3.4") load-path))
(setq w3m-command (concat "c:/cygwin/usr/local/bin/w3m.exe" ""))
(load-library "w3m")
;;; causes the return key to submit a form
(setq w3m-use-form t)
(if (eq window-system 'w32)
(setq w3m-content-type-alist
'(("text/plain" "\\.\\(txt\\|tex\\|el\\)" nil)
("text/html" "\\.s?html?$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/jpeg" "\\.jpe?g$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/png" "\\.png$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/gif" "\\.gif$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/tiff" "\\.tif?f$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/x-xwd" "\\.xwd$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/x-xbm" "\\.xbm$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/x-xpm" "\\.xpm$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("image/x-bmp" "\\.bmp$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("video/mpeg" "\\.mpe?g$" w32-shellex-on-object file)
("video/quicktime" "\\.mov$" w32-shellex-on-object file file)
("application/postscript" "\\.\\(ps\\|eps\\)$"
w32-shellex-on-object file)
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---
